Hy smokinjoe3 there is a basic test for the Hydrovac function before you start the truck jump in and pump the brake pedal a couple of times now press and hold the brake pedal and start the engine if the Hydrovac is working you should feel the brake pedal move closer to the floor once the engine starts.

Corrosive brake fluid is the 1 reason why calipers and wheel cylinders begin to seize as corrosion inside the bores of the cylinder occurs from the contaminated fluid. It can also be caused by a faulty master brake cylinder or a bad brake booster.

If you can pull it up a little before something stops it eg underside of floor the return spring is either absent or insufficient and the weight of the pedal is riding on the master and this can result in your problem.
